Deranged Dreadnoughts are Enduring Dreadnoughts that strayed too close to The Clockwork Sun and were ravaged by its light. The glass-riddled locomotives and their crews now roam Albion, attacking anyone they come across.

Description[ | ]

Deranged Dreadnoughts are hostile and aggressive enemies. Their gun fires 10 projectiles that deal 1 Hull damage per hit, but can knock your locomotive back. Their turret fires a homing projectile that deal 6 Hull per hit. Their Hull is slightly less durable than a regular Dreadnaught's (110 vs 120). Destroying the Dreadnought gives you 229 Experience.

The higher The Strength of the Sun, the more frequently these locomotives can be encountered.

The Deranged Dreadnought's rabid aggression is stilled now. Your lights reveal glassy growths encasing sections of its ravaged hull. Where the battle has shattered them, they spill across the sky in a plume of shards and dust.
